Climate Chart: Topeka (USA)

Topeka, the capital city of Kansas, experiences a continental climate with four distinct seasons. Summers are hot and humid with temperatures averaging around 90°F (32°C), while winters are cold with temperatures dropping to around 30°F (-1°C). Spring and fall offer mild temperatures, making them pleasant times to visit.

Climate Data Overview for Topeka, USA

Explore the comprehensive climate data for Topeka, USA. This detailed table provides valuable insights into temperature variations, precipitation levels, and seasonal changes, helping you understand the unique weather patterns of this region.

Month ⌀ Temperature °C ⌀ Rain (mm) ⌀ Snow (mm) ⌀ Sunshine (h)
Jan -0.3 0.72 0.31 6.57
Feb 0.5 0.78 0.40 7.65
Mar 7.3 2.10 0.16 7.94
Apr 12.7 3.21 0.04 9.15
May 18.8 4.98 0.00 9.46
Jun 25.0 3.63 0.00 11.85
Jul 26.4 3.38 0.00 11.67
Aug 25.4 3.01 0.00 11.09
Sep 22.6 2.67 0.00 9.95
Oct 14.6 2.86 0.02 8.14
Nov 7.1 1.40 0.12 7.00
Dec 2.1 1.09 0.18 6.23
⌀ Month 13.5 2.49 0.10 8.89
